Verse 48.26

अवश्यं तु मया कार्यं प्रियं तस्य महात्मनः ।
जीवितेनापि रामस्य तथा दशरथस्य च ॥ २६ ॥

avaśyaṃ tu mayā kāryaṃ priyaṃ tasya mahātmanaḥ |
jīvitenāpi rāmasya tathā daśarathasya ca || 26 ||
